Output 63c045774d651297eab2ebeeffca05c1620933b93f313058dae497ab0ec8a6cb:0

value
12521800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b928e7684906548808b6ee2f50d8716b066f48c8 OP_EQUAL
address
3Ja3w62ycMF5r5QFZrAh4dm44kbtM3K8zs
transaction
63c045774d651297eab2ebeeffca05c1620933b93f313058dae497ab0ec8a6cb
spent
true